The logistics and supply chain management environment consists of a range of key areas which requires in depth understanding, analysis and monitoring & control. One of these areas is the financial aspect of logistics and supply chain management, more specifically the Cost-Volume-Profit (CVP) approach and breakeven point.
CVP analysis is the study of the effect that changes in variable and fixed costs, sales price and sales volume have on profitability. It is clear that a reduction in volume of units sold, for instance, will have an impact on the profit generated, however the exact amount of the reduction, and consequently impact on profit, is more difficult to assess. Therefore, CVP analysis is a great tool to use in these instances.
